A (also called an extended or expanded typeface) features characters with greater horizontal width, creating a commanding, stable, or retro-futuristic look. When such a font is in beta —meaning it’s feature-complete but still undergoing testing for kerning, hinting, or OpenType features—designers often call it a “beta font.” These are typically distributed to a closed group for feedback before the official 1.0 release.
